Nikki and I joined a shore excursion from the Regent Seven Seas Mariner in Halifax, Nova Scotia, that took us to Fairview Lawn Cemetery, the final resting place of 121 Titanic victims. In this video, we walk through the Titanic graves section and reflect on the stories behind these simple headstones and Halifax’s role in the disaster’s aftermath.
